Trade-offs: Telehealth follow-up vs In-person visits
- Access & wait times - which can you actually attend weekly?
- Specialty depth for your condition vs general multi-specialty convenience
- Insurance cashless panels and total 90-day cost (consults + labs + meds)
- Continuity: same clinician over months vs one-off second opinions
- Emergency and diagnostics on the same campus vs separate trips
- Ask whether your insurance panel or cash package includes labs and reviews - fragmented care is expensive.
Evaluation checklist
- Licence and accreditation appropriate to India (state medical council / NABH where relevant)
- Relevant specialty credentials for Telehealth vs In-Person Care
- Transparent pricing or insurance cashless clarity
- Access: wait times, evening/weekend slots, telehealth follow-up
- Outcomes mindset: do they track labs, weight, BP, symptoms over time?
- Medication safety: legitimate pharmacy channels only - avoid informal injectables
